Output 77e857630f91ad01c1b7fe4e7d25047aafc07c45b62570a4b939e73adef60350:1

value
11440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04a70905c4e79ba134fb1a1d621f9250e05a4ff7 OP_EQUAL
address
327cj875EpzreWv6khqQYSbq5WXMFNbyyu
transaction
77e857630f91ad01c1b7fe4e7d25047aafc07c45b62570a4b939e73adef60350
spent
true